HCL Technologies Fresher Eligibility Requirement & Criteria

HCL is one of the preferred technology companies in India by engineers graduating in CS/IT and electronics related branches. I see a lot of candidates are searching for the recruitment eligibility criteria of HCL. I found the following information -

MCA + Engineering : Branches: Computer Science, IT, Electronics & Electrical, Electronics & Instrumentation, Electronics & Communications

BCA+BSC: Maths, Science, Computer Science, Electronics

Minimum 60% throughout in all the exams: 10th, 12th, all engineering semesters (until the last one at the time of recruitment) - for campus recruitment.

For off campus, the minimum percentage requirement is 65% throughout.

Selection Process: The initial elimination tests will include logical ability, quantitative ability and English language skills. Clearing this step will lead you to technical and then HR round of interview.

In the technical round of interviews - major emphasis is given on knowledge of engineering subjects, C, C++, Java, .Net (based on what you've mentioned in your resume).
